Avocado Miami Red Butter Fruit Variety Grafted Plant

Product Features and Variety

The Avocado (Persea americana), also known as Butter Fruit, is a highly prized evergreen fruit tree. This offering is a grafted Miami Red variety, which is propagated to encourage earlier and more reliable fruiting, and is suitable for growing in both the ground and large containers.

  • Botanical Name: Persea americana
  • Variety: Miami Red Avocado, a Grafted Plant/Tree.
  • Size: 1.5–3 Feet Height.
  • Suitability: Thrives in tropical and subtropical Indian climates and is excellent for both ground planting and container gardening.

The Fruit: Miami Red Avocado

The Miami Red Avocado is a unique cultivar celebrated for its striking appearance and creamy texture:

  • Appearance and Color: The outer skin turns a vibrant red hue when fully ripe, a distinctive feature from common green avocados. The inner flesh remains a beautiful greenish-gold color.
  • Texture and Taste: The flesh is highly valued for its soft, pliable texture, high moisture content, and rich, buttery, nutty flavor.
  • Culinary Use: Perfect for consumption fresh, in salads, or for making rich and flavorful guacamole.

Essential Care Guide for Indian Climates

Sunlight and Climate Needs

  • Sunlight: The plant requires full sun exposure, needing at least 6-8 hours of direct sunlight daily for optimal health and fruit production.
  • Climate: Avocado trees grow best in warm and humid tropical to subtropical conditions.

Watering and Soil

  • Soil: Use a well-draining soil mix that is rich in organic matter. Avocado trees are sensitive to waterlogged roots.
  • Watering: Water deeply and consistently. Allow the top inch of soil to dry out between waterings. Ensure the pot or planting location has excellent drainage to prevent root rot.
